Solution for 7(x+4)+9=10x-3(x-4) equation:


Simplifying
7(x + 4) + 9 = 10x + -3(x + -4)

Reorder the terms:
7(4 + x) + 9 = 10x + -3(x + -4)
(4 * 7 + x * 7) + 9 = 10x + -3(x + -4)
(28 + 7x) + 9 = 10x + -3(x + -4)

Reorder the terms:
28 + 9 + 7x = 10x + -3(x + -4)

Combine like terms: 28 + 9 = 37
37 + 7x = 10x + -3(x + -4)

Reorder the terms:
37 + 7x = 10x + -3(-4 + x)
37 + 7x = 10x + (-4 * -3 + x * -3)
37 + 7x = 10x + (12 + -3x)

Reorder the terms:
37 + 7x = 12 + 10x + -3x

Combine like terms: 10x + -3x = 7x
37 + 7x = 12 + 7x

Add '-7x' to each side of the equation.
37 + 7x + -7x = 12 + 7x + -7x

Combine like terms: 7x + -7x = 0
37 + 0 = 12 + 7x + -7x
37 = 12 + 7x + -7x

Combine like terms: 7x + -7x = 0
37 = 12 + 0
37 = 12

Solving
37 = 12

Couldn't find a variable to solve for.

This equation is invalid, the left and right sides are not equal, therefore there is no solution.
